Title: | Optimization-based trade-off analysis of biodiesel crop production for managing an agricultural catchment |
Authors: | Lautenbach, S., M. Volk, M. Strauch, G. Whittaker and R. Seppelt |
Year: | 2013 |
Journal: | Environmental Modelling & Software |
Volume (Issue): | 48 |
Pages: | 98-112 |
Article ID: | |
DOI: | http://dx.doi.org/10.1016/j.envsoft.2013.06.00610.1016/j.envsoft.2013.06.006 |
URL (non-DOI journals): | |
Model: | SWAT |
Broad Application Category: | hydrologic and pollutant |
Primary Application Category: | bioenergy crop, tree and/or vegetation assessment |
Secondary Application Category: | BMP assessment (genetic algorithm or similar optimization approach) |
Watershed Description: | 315 km^2 Parthe which is a tributary of the Weisse Elster River (within the larger Elbe River system) and is located in the State of Saxony in Central Germany. |
